[摘要]ECShop是一款开源免费的网上商店系统,能够免费下载、无偿使用、免费升级,无功能限制。虽然ECShop是个庞大复杂网店系统,但ECShop搬家过程确实简单方便的,今日就详细讲解下ECShop这个最大的开源网店系统的搬家过程。sql
有时候因为备案被注销,虚拟主机不够用等各类方面的缘由,网站搬家是再所不免的,网站搬家便是把网站从一个服务器空间搬到另外一个服务器空间,更深刻地说就是把网站的数据从原来的服务器转移到新的服务器上。ECShop这个最大的开源网店系统的搬家过程是简单方便,并不复杂,ECShop整站迁移的过程主要分为如下3个步骤:数据库
旧站数据备份
新站数据导入
商品图片恢复服务器
搬家前注意事项工具
1.请尽可能在浏览人数少的时候(建议在午夜1点后)进行测试
2.请确认新空间与旧空间的MYSQL数据库版本一致(不然数据没法恢复,若是不一致请用工具转换一下)网站
3.请确认2边的数据库前缀一致,EC默认的是"ecs_ ",如不一样,请从新安装新站,或者修改备份数据中的前缀名(修改备份文件的前缀名有风险)blog
4.请关闭旧站,以避免产生新的数据。图片
5.请在肯定新站迁移完成后,再删除旧站及数据备份。登录
第一步:旧站数据备份后台
1.进入ECShop的网站后台,依次选择 数据库管理—>数据库备份,选择所有备份,分卷这里最好是2048及如下,若是分卷文件太大了会在新站那导入失败的,以下图:
2. 用FTP工具登录旧的网站空间,进入data/sqldata/文件夹下,就能看到刚才全部备份出来的文件了(后缀名为:sql),而后把它们下载到你的电脑里。
第二步:新站导入
1.用FTP登录新站的空间,进入data/sqldata/文件夹,把刚才下载到本地的备份文件所有传到这个文件夹内。
2.而后登陆新网站的后台,选择数据库管理—>据库备份—>恢复备份,在这里你会看到刚才传上去的数据库备份文件,点操做下的导入开始恢复数据,以下图:
耐心等待片刻后,恢复成功!
第三步:恢复商品图片
1.用FTP进入旧站空间,在跟目录下找到images文件夹,把这整个文件夹下载到本地。
2.从新登录新站的空间,把images文件夹改个名字(好比images111),再把刚才从旧站上下载下来的images文件夹上传到新站跟目录下。
3.最后登录新站后台—>商品管理—>图片批量处理—>肯定(保持默认设置就行),开始图片批量处理。过程会比较慢,须要耐心等待。若是商品不少,能够按商品分类一个分类一个分类的批量处理。
4.等图片批量处理所有完成后,请登录前台,作如下测试:
检查商品图片无误
登录一个用户名,退出,再登录
下一个定单走一遍流程
新注册一个用户名,登录再退出
登录后台,进入商品管理,点一件商品进行编辑
登录后台,进入一个会员资料,进行编辑修改
进入定单管理,找个定单修改处理一下
若是以上操做没有问题的话,那么系统迁移成功!以上就是ECShop搬家的整个过程,仍是很简单的。